Self-care is the practice of taking action to maintain one's health and well-being. It is a diverse and vast range, with there being various types of self-care techniques overall. Generally speaking, among the most significant and most essential aspects of self-care is physical self-care, which is all about keeping our bodies as fit and healthy as feasible. This includes practices like drinking the suggested 2-3 litres of water each day, sleeping for about 7-9 hours at night and engaging in regular physical exercise, whether it's a vigorous stroll or a gym workout. Obviously, one of the crucial physical self-care examples is eating a healthy, nutritious and well balanced diet regimen with a lot of lean protein, unsaturated fats and fruits and vegetables. By doing this, you are nurturing your body, sustaining a healthy weight, and increasing your energy levels. Among the most vital kinds of self-care is emotional self-care, which refers to our ability to regulate our emotions and cope with challenging feelings as they arise. It is all about finding handy actions to connect with our emotions and process them in a healthy and balanced way. For some people, they have found that emotional self-care techniques like journalling their thoughts, practicing mindfulness and going to counseling are exceptionally helpful. Another excellent emotional self-care suggestion is to spend more time in nature. This is because research has actually found that being in nature can have a very healing, therapeutic and restorative effect on our mental and emotional health.
